Athabasca Oil (TSE:ATH – Get Free Report) posted its earnings results on Thursday. The oil and gas exploration company reported C$0.13 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, FiscalAI reports. Athabasca Oil had a return on equity of 12.23% and a net margin of 16.25%.The firm had revenue of C$306.54 million for the quarter.

Athabasca Oil Company Profile
Athabasca Oil Corp is an energy company. It is focused on the exploration, development, and production of light oil and liquids-rich natural gas. The company organizes its business under two operational segments, Light Oil and Thermal Oil. It generates maximum revenue from the Thermal Oil segment. Thermal Oil includes the exploration, development, and production of bitumen from sand and carbonate rock formations located in the Athabasca region of Northern Alberta.
